迅维网

什么是运营商劫持?DNS劫持和HTTP劫持的区别

zjmanager 2018-2-26 15:46


  中国互联网经过这么多年的沉浮,地下黑色产业链已经有了很大的变化。随着免费杀毒软件的流行,中国互联网发生了一些比较明显的变化,比如曾经盗号木马横行,现在就很少见了。但是,黑色产业并没有消失,而是转型做起来其他的买卖。

什么是运营商劫持?DNS劫持和HTTP劫持的区别 图


什么是运营商劫持

  运营商是指那些提供宽带服务的ISP,包括三大运营商中国电信、中国移动、中国联通,还有一些小运营商,比如长城宽带、歌华有线宽带。运营商提供最最基础的网络服务,掌握着通往用户物理大门的钥匙,目前运营商劫持也很普遍,百度一下,可以发现有大量反馈反馈这个问题,各种广告弹窗,甚至还可能会窃取用户因素,令人憎恨。

  网络运营商为了卖广告或者其他经济利益,有时候会直接劫持用户的访问,目前,运营商比较常见的作恶方式有两种,分别是DNS劫持、HTTP劫持。

DNS劫持

  DNS是Domain Name System的简写,即域名系统,它作为可以将域名和IP地址相互映射的一个分布式数据库,能够使人更方便的访问互联网。简单地说,如果我们想访问迅维网,本来需要输入网站主机的IP地址,但是DNS可以将www.chinafix.com解析成对应的IP地址,我们就不需要记住复杂的IP地址了。

  先看几个DNS劫持的案例:

  微云弹出的迷你浏览器直接跳转到114导航;

什么是运营商劫持?DNS劫持和HTTP劫持的区别 图


  Steam内置浏览器被跳转到某个宣传赚钱的微信文章页(此页面欺骗性太大, 未必是运营商所为)

什么是运营商劫持?DNS劫持和HTTP劫持的区别 图


  DNS劫持有这三种情况:

  1、错误域名解析到纠错导航页面,导航页面存在广告。判断方法:访问的域名是错误的,而且跳转的导航页面也是官方的,如电信的114,联通移网域名纠错导航页面。

  2、错误域名解析到非正常页面,对错误的域名解析到导航页的基础上,有一定几率解析到一些恶意站点,这些恶意站点通过判断你访问的目标HOST、URI、 referrer等来确定是否跳转广告页面,这种情况就有可能导致跳转广告页面(域名输错)或者访问页面被加广告(页面加载时有些元素的域名错误而触发)这种劫持会对用户访问的目标HOST、URI、 referrer等会进行判定来确定是否解析恶意站点地址,不易被发现。

  3、直接将特点站点解析到恶意或者广告页面,这种情况比较恶劣,而且出现这种情况未必就是运营商所为,家里路由器被黑,或者系统被入侵,甚至运营商的某些节点被第三方恶意控制都有可能。具体情况要具体分析,这里就不展开了。

  DNS劫持常见于使用自动的DNS地址,所以,不管有没有被劫持,尽量不要使用运营商默认的DNS,用户可以通过修改DNS来解决。

什么是运营商劫持?DNS劫持和HTTP劫持的区别 图


什么是运营商劫持?DNS劫持和HTTP劫持的区别 图


HTTP劫持

  HTTP劫持:你DNS解析的域名的IP地址不变。在和网站交互过程中的劫持了你的请求。在网站发给你信息前就给你返回了请求。

  HTTP劫持很好判断,当年正常访问一个无广告的页面时,页面上出现广告弹窗,八成就是运营商劫持了HTTP。下图中,右下角的广告并不是所访问的网站放置的(懂技术的,可以查看网页源代码进行监控,就能辨别)。

什么是运营商劫持?DNS劫持和HTTP劫持的区别 图


  HTTP劫持比较出名的是360导航的首页,曾经被某运营商弹出广告,而且只有用户打开360导航时才会出现该广告,以至于很多用户认为这是360自己的广告,引发了大量投诉,结果最后被证实是运营商干的。

  关于DNS劫持和HTTP劫持,打个比方来描述这两种劫持,DNS劫持就是你想去存钱运营商却把你拉到了劫匪手中;而HTTP劫持就是你从服务器买了一包零食电信给你放了脏东西,横竖都很恶心人。

  目前,解决HTTP劫持的方法主要是网站启用HTTPS加密,目前知名大网站基本都启用了HTTPS加密访问,不过采用HTTPS加密会提升网站运营商成本,目前中小网站相对还没有普及开来。

解决办法

  如果你遇到类似情况,可以先给运营商打电话投诉,说明自己遇到劫持了。一般情况下客服会说你可能是中毒了,不要紧坚持说自己用的是Mac,不会中毒,让对方解决。

什么是运营商劫持?DNS劫持和HTTP劫持的区别 图



雷人

握手

鲜花

鸡蛋

路过
收藏
来自: 电脑百事网
关闭

站长提醒 上一条 /1 下一条

返回顶部
附近
店铺
微信扫码查看附近店铺
维修
报价
扫码查看手机版报价
信号元
件查询
点位图


芯片搜索